It is Not Just An American Thing
It is an "us" thing as people. Humans, regardless of their race, nationality, or creed, rank slots higher than any other form of wagering. In the United Kingdom, for example, around £3 billion of the £5 billion that online gambling (in all forms) generates each year comes from online slots alone.
That means that it outperforms every other table game, along with online sports wagering, too, which is impressive in a country where half a million people travel to watch their local football teams on a Saturday.
It is the same story in the special administrative region of China – Macao. This region now has more and bigger casinos than Las Vegas, and rakes in a large amount more in annual revenues than Sin City. It, too, brings in the vast majority of its money from online slots.
Ease of Uptake
When you want to do something new, there are typically barriers in place before you can get set up. Sometimes it is equipment, other times it is intricate and confusing rules, and in some cases it is a fan base that likes to gate-keep.
Online slots have none of these barriers. Unlike their fellow casino games, they don’t have a set of complex rules to get your head around, or off-puttingly large buy-ins. Slots are the definition of plug-and-play, and that simplicity is a hit with the public.
